ptguard12 Posted December 4, 2010 Report Share Posted December 4, 2010 (edited) Moore County will probably go through the district undefeated. The only team with a shot of beating them is Forrest, especially when the game is at Chapel Hill. Forrest has the guard play to compete, and I think their defensive pressure will cause Moore County some problems. However, they don't have much inside to handle Vann or Raby. I don't see Cascade coming within single digits of beating Moore County. Moore County's weaknesses are their inexperienced PG play and their depth. However, their inside play is dominant, and likely the best in the state. They are also one of the most versatile teams in the state as Vann, Raby, Garland, and Howell can all play multiple spots on the floor. I think Moore County gets to sub-state without much trouble.
